一、系统概述
该系统利用Python强大的数据处理能力和Django等高效的Web框架,连接各类健康监测设备,如智能手环、血压计、血糖仪等,实时采集老年人的生理数据,包括心率、血压、血糖、睡眠情况等。同时,系统还支持手动录入健康数据,如症状、用药情况等,以确保数据的全面性。通过对采集到的健康数据进行分析,系统能够建立健康模型,并根据设定的阈值和异常判断规则,识别潜在的健康问题。
二、核心功能
实时监测与预警:系统能够实时监测老年人的生理数据,一旦发现异常数据,立即发出预警信息,通过短信、APP推送等方式通知老年人及其家属,以便及时采取措施。
健康档案管理:为每位老年人建立详细的健康档案,记录其基本信息、病史、体检报告、健康监测数据等,形成一个完整的健康记录。医生和家属可以随时查看健康档案,了解老年人的健康状况变化趋势,为诊断和护理提供参考。
远程监护与沟通:家属可以通过手机APP远程查看老年人的实时健康数据和活动情况,实现远程监护。系统还内置沟通功能,方便老年人与家属、医生之间进行文字、语音或视频交流,及时获取健康建议和指导。
提醒功能:设置服药提醒、体检提醒等功能,确保老年人按时服药和进行定期体检。
健康知识教育:提供健康知识教育模块,包括疾病预防、饮食营养、康复护理等方面的知识,帮助老年人提升健康意识和自我管理能力。
部分代码
def users_login(request):
if request.method in ["POST", "GET"]:
msg = {
'code': normal_code, "msg": mes.normal_code}
req_dict = request.session.get("req_dict")
if req_dict.get('role')!=None:
del req_dict['role']
datas = users.getbyparams(users, users, req_dict)
if not datas:
msg['code'] = password_error_code
msg['msg'] = mes.password_error_code
return JsonResponse(msg)
req_dict['id'] = datas[0].get('id')
return Auth.authenticate(Auth, users, req_dict)
def users_register